Confirmation Driving Pattern

  1. Connect the hand-held tester to the DLC3, or connect the tester probes of the oscilloscope between terminals OX1A, OX1B and E1 of the ECM connector.
  2. Start the engine and warm it up with all the accessories switched OFF until the engine coolant temperature becomes stable.
  3. Run the engine at 2,500 to 3,000 RPM for about 3 minutes.
  4. After confirming that the waveform of the bank 1 sensor 1 (OX1A) which oscillates between 0 V and 1 V under a feedback to the ECM, check the waveform of the bank 1 sensor 2 (OX2A).
    NOTE:

    If there is malfunction in the system, the waveform of "sensor 2" (OX2A) may become a similar to the one of "sensor 1" (OX1A) as shown in the diagram on the left.
